Why isn't there more teacher-developed digital content? Probably because traditional IWB authoring software is not great at producing eLearning materials. eLearning materials need to be able to be 'information giving' but must also, importantly, contain the opportunity for inclusion of student tasks, differentiation and personalization. Teachers are turning to flash-based content to address this issue. Highly polished professionally produced digital learning flash objects such as the Learning Federation Objects require a high level of skill to create. Some teachers have taken upon themselves to develop flash programming skills and are making some great activities. However; this will rightly only ever be a minority.
